2.9.1 — Key rotation for the Fallowbird crash-report pipeline. Old ingest signing key retired after the Queximo symbolication incident; all crash uploads from app builds 480+ must be signed with the replacement. Dashboards were re-pointed; no schema change. Maintainers: rotate again in six months, same procedure. The active pipeline signing key is recorded below.

deploy key for kajof-yawif: bky9_fvxrpdHPq

Every crash report ingested by Crashline is tagged with the exact build that produced it. When the Fernwick mobile app compiles, our CI stamps the binary with a provenance record covering the commit, toolchain version, and signing profile. The crash-report pipeline reads this stamp before symbolication, so mismatched builds are rejected early rather than producing garbage stack traces. New team members should verify the stamp whenever a report looks suspicious. For reference, the current release stamp is shown below.

trace token, fafog-kageg: htk4_98e6

## Support

StageGrid, the seat-map renderer for the Velmora Playhouse platform, follows a two-week patch cadence. Release managers should file rendering defects with a seat-map snapshot attached; without one, triage is deferred. Hotfixes are reserved for sold-out-performance blockers only, and require sign-off from the rendering lead. For release coordination or hotfix approval, write to the team directly.

escalation mailbox, bafog-fafog: ulador@paliqlabs.internal

## Changelog — Font vendoring defaults changed

As of this release, the Bracken UI build no longer fetches third-party fonts at build time. All typefaces used by the Lanternwell suite are now vendored into the repo under a dedicated assets directory, and the fetch step is skipped by default. If you're onboarding, nothing to install — the fonts travel with the checkout. The build flags controlling this behavior are listed below.

settings of hadup-yafog:
LAMAEL_PIN=3761
LAMAEL_TENANT=istmir
LAMAEL_METRICS_HOST=metrics.lamael.plorvasys.test
LAMAEL_SEAL=seal_8ea68500
LAMAEL_STANDBY_TEAM=fraok